#4d1e59 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4d1e59 is composed of 30.2% red, 11.8%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 13.5% cyan, 66.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 287.8 degrees, a saturation of 49.6% and a lightness of 23.3%. #4d1e59 color hex could be obtained by blending #9a3cb2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#4d1e59

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#f9f1f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d1e59

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d393e is the less saturated color, while #5d0374 is the most saturated one.
